
1. 可在预分配内存(如内存池、栈数组)中直接调用构造函数,提升性能,适用于嵌入式或实时系统;2. 配合内存池实现高效对象管理,减少系统调用,便于追踪内存使用;3. 支持共享内存中构建对象,满足进程间通信需求,确保布局一致;4. 允许栈上延迟构造,按条件初始化对象以节省资源。 下面将详细介绍如何进行...

支付网关的文档中通常会明确指出这种行为,例如:“响应的HTTP状态码为302,并且Location头被设置为redirectUri,这可能会触发自动重定向以及接收HTML格式的响应。 赋值运算符在日常编程中非常常用,掌握它们能让代码更简洁高效。 指针与引用的结合使用,关键在于理解“引用是别名,指针是...

Go提供了 replace 指令来实现这一功能,可以在 go.mod 文件中重定向模块路径和版本。 只要掌握 push、pop、top 和 empty 四个核心操作,就能应对大多数使用场景。 当你的系统需要与外部第三方系统(供应商、合作伙伴、支付平台等)进行数据交换时,如果对方有自己的XML规范,或...

可以使用循环遍历数据数组,逐行逐列写入。 虽然Go不支持直接将包作为函数调用,但其 包名.标识符 的访问模式清晰且符合其语言设计哲学。 Python会对一些小的整数和字符串进行intern,这意味着相同的字面量会指向内存中的同一个对象。 此外,curl 命令也支持使用 --url 选项来明确指定 U...

这对于保持网站视觉一致性或重用特定内容元素非常有用。 这意味着T32_Breakpoint是一个类型别名,等同于struct t32_breakpoint。 建议使用安全断言或反射进一步判断。 语义更清晰:使用 empty() 明确表达“判断是否为空”的意图,提高代码可读性。 钉钉 AI 助理 钉钉...

package main import ( "encoding/json" "fmt" ) func main() { // 待解码的JSON数据(字节切片形式) srcJSON := []byte(`{"bar":{"hello":"world"},"foo":{"bar":"new","baz"...

在python正则表达式中,`re.search` 函数的 `|` 字符具有特殊含义,表示逻辑“或”操作。 应根据需求选择方法,并注意负数处理。 打开日志文件 使用std::ofstream创建或打开一个文件用于写入日志。 这个法则并不是语言标准中的硬性规定,而是一种编程实践中的最佳建议。 字典查询...

带前缀的命名空间(Prefixed Namespace):xmlns:prefix="URI" 声明方式: 在一个元素上,通过xmlns:prefix属性将一个前缀(prefix)映射到一个URI。 可增加日志输出请求来源 IP 和路径 启用 Go 的 pprof 或添加中间件记录请求生命周期,判断...

这对于查看哪些地方需要格式化很有用。 Go语言安装需下载对应系统包并配置环境变量。 用户可能有基本信息(ID、姓名、邮箱),还有地址信息(街道、城市、邮编),再往深了说,可能还有账户信息(余额、交易记录)。 这个客户端实现了Go标准库的http.Client接口,但其底层通过URL Fetch服务代...

即构数智人 即构数智人是由即构科技推出的AI虚拟数字人视频创作平台,支持数字人形象定制、短视频创作、数字人直播等。 Go语言利用goroutine和channel实现高效并发,通过WebSocket协议构建聊天室,核心在于使用Hub模式管理客户端连接与消息广播,结合sync.Mutex保证并发安全,...